Rolf (rolf@pointsman.de) from the tDOM team on tDOM extension + functions:

+ +
+

If an XPath expr (both for the selectNodes method and in XSLT + stylesheets) uses a not standard XPath function name (you cannot + 'overwrite' the C coded standard built-in functions), the engine + looks, if there is a tcl proc with the given function name in + the ::dom::xpathFunc:: namespace. In other words: all extension + functions procs must reside in the namespace ::dom::xpathFunc or + in a child namespace of that namespace. If the XPath extension + function has a prefix, the prefix is expanded to the namespace + URI and that namespace URI must be the name of the child + namespace of the ::dom::xpathFunc namespace.

+ +

If there is such a proc, this proc is called with the following + arguments: ctxNode pos nodeListType nodeList args. The 'args' + are, as type/value pairs, the arguments, that are given to the + extension functions. (E.g. if you have + myExtensionFunction('foo'), you will get two args, the first + "string" the second "foo").

+ +

The tcl proc, which implements the extension function must + return a list of two elements: { }. The possible + types at the moment are: "bool", "number", "string", "nodes".

+ +

But don't get confused by my probably (too) vague + explanations. Just look at the examples in the xpath.test and + tdom.tcl files. For almost all 'real life' needs, you should get + it very fast, what to do from that usage examples.
